The Secret Lives of Mormon Wives star Taylor Frankie PaulĀ is allegedly under investigation for a third domestic violence incident involving her and Dakota Mortensen, her ex-boyfriend/baby daddy.
A police spokesperson in Utah confirmed toĀ NBC NewsĀ that officials were investigating another incident connected to TFP and Dakota, which reportedly occurred in 2024.
What we know so far:
It was reported that Dakota had contacted the stateās Police Department last month. Due to the case being an open investigation, the spokesman declined to provide further details.
While they couldnāt share exact dates regarding the alleged incident, they said that authorities had been reviewing multiple videos.
The police department has yet to speak to TFP regarding the alleged third domestic violence incident. Officials only have the details that Dakota has provided.
Investigators have spoken to Taylorās attorney regarding the matter. Authorities now want TFP to come in for an interview or submit a written statement.
Dakota told police that heād been advised to contact the West Jordan department after initially contacting the Draper Police Department due to the jurisdiction in which the alleged 2024 incident occurred.
TFP’s DV history:
In February 2023, Taylor was arrested in Herriman, Utah, following a physical altercation with Dakota.Ā TFP was accused of hitting Dakota as he tried to leave their residence. She threw “heavy metal chairs” at him, one of which struck her then-5-year-old daughter in the head, causing a “goose-egg” injury.
She was initially charged with felony aggravated assault, domestic violence in the presence of a child, child abuse, and criminal mischief. In August 2023, Taylor pleaded guilty to a third-degree felony count ofĀ aggravated assault.
If she completes three years of probation without further law violations, the charge will be reduced to a misdemeanor … well, that didn’t happen.
New allegations surfaced in February and March 2026. Dakota filed for a protective order and temporary custody of their son, Ever. He claimed that Taylor choked him and struck him during arguments on February 23 and 24. The Draper City Police Department confirmed an active “domestic assault investigation” with “allegations made in both directions.”
